This amusing western has a racial equality angle, an avalanche, a locoweed stampede, Shelley Winters chomping cigars, and Agnesan educated horse that sits on its rear end for a strategy conference with Burt Lancaster. Most important, it has Ossie Davis, one of the nation's finest Negro actors.
Davis is beguilingly guileful as a runaway slave who changes hands like a dirty dollar. He is captured by a band of Indians, who unload him on Fur Trapper Lancaster as "payment" for the load of skins they steal from him. The redskins, in turn, are zapped...
